Features of an Inclusive school

Two features of an inclusive school are firstly: good communication among staff, (Administrators, head teachers, teachers assistant etc.) and secondly resources. Good communication among staff develops a positive attitudes in creating an inclusive school. Resources, making sure it is available as it will encourage learners with difficulties to feel as though they belong. It can improve self-esteem, willingness to participate in activity and also provide a lot support for teachers.
